Hunnicutt Aromatically, this wine exhibits black cherry, vanilla, eucalyptus and mocha. The nose is complemented with dark fruit, toast, dried cherry, and blueberry on the palate. I would suggest decanting this wine for at least 30 minutes prior to drinking.

Kirk Venge, winemaker
As the primary winemaker at Venge Vineyards, Kirk Venge’s solid
foundation and passion for winemaking began at a very young age. He grew up in
Rutherford, in the heart of the Napa Valley surrounded by some of the best
wines and appellations in the world. His childhood memories are steeped in
vineyard farming, winemaking and the fragrance of a wine cellar. Some of
Kirk’s earliest memories of the winery were when he was four years old helping
his father Nils with basket-pressing Cabernet from the family’s Saddleback
Vineyard and manning the pump switch on late night barrel racking
projects. A game the two of them would play was for Kirk to smell and
guess the varietal of wine in a glass when Nils would pal around amongst his
peers.
